About Advanced College Diploma - Business Administration - Accounting (02111) (Optional Co-op)
Humber’s Business Administration – Accounting advanced diploma program covers a number of areas including accounting theory, procedures and best practices. Detailed instruction is provided in bookkeeping, auditing, taxation, business law, information systems, finance and management. Students will gain hands-on experience in industry-standard software such as Profile (personal and corporate tax), Access, Excel, PowerBI, SAGE 50 Accounting (formerly known as Simply Accounting) and Accpac Plus. Students will also learn accounting from industry-connected faculty who will provide learner with practical, hands-on accounting training to help students get ahead. Humber's program’s versatile range of courses helps students also develop broad-based business skills including human resource administration, business writing, macroeconomics and finance.
Outside of the classroom, Humber's accounting program students are supported by the college's full-time dedicated help resources in the Humber Accounting Centre.
There are a limited number of spaces for students to mix co-op work experience with their academic learning in alternating semesters through an optional co-op program. This co-op program is structured to include from one to three co-op work terms, taking place between academic terms. Participation in the co-op program may increase time to complete the diploma by one to three semesters. The optional co-op program provides students with an opportunity to gain valuable experience. Co-op work opportunities are not guaranteed as the job placement opportunities are competitive.
Students not selected for co-op placements will complete the standard 84-hour work placement course in their final semester. Through this course, they will put their accounting knowledge and skills into practice. Students find a placement with support from the business placement advisor who maintains a roster of placement opportunities and provides students with direction and assistance in the development of resumés and job search techniques.
